Way too late to be of use to the OP I would think, but just for info, you can delay the shift by setting the kickdown to the maximum pressures within the limits set, so it's not so high as to give a bump when engaging gear, and also in an effort to make the 65 more "sporty" when used in the Stag the 1-2 and 2-3 shift valves and springs were altered to delay the change, so these can be fitted. (As long as you're not using a Stag box in the first place......)

Best solution is to fit a Range Control Valve which allows you to engage 1st and 2nd gear on the selector and hold them regardless of engine revs or roadspeed without any automatic changes.
